Senate Amending The CCT Law (photo) - saharareportes by Zeusd3(m): 8:13am On Apr 15, 2016
Due to the case before the code of conduct tribunal against the Senate President, senator bukola saraki, the Senate has moved to amend the code of conduct act.
As the Senate moves to decriminalize corruption by Amending the code of conduct of bureau / tribunal law.
Here is a picture of the bill being proposed...
